Ingredients List

Here’s what you’ll need to create this delectable dish:
- 2 cups sushi rice – for that perfect sticky base
- 3 cups water – to cook the rice to fluffy perfection
- 1 lb fresh salmon fillet – rich in omega-3 fatty acids
- 2 tablespoons mayonnaise – adds creaminess
- 1 tablespoon sriracha sauce – for that delightful kick
- 2 teaspoons soy sauce – complements the salmon beautifully
- 1 teaspoon sesame oil – enhances the umami flavor
- 1 avocado, sliced – adds creaminess and nutrients
- 2 green onions, chopped – for freshness and crunch
- Nori sheets (seaweed) – to give it that sushi touch
Substitutions:
- Brown rice can be used for a healthier option.
- Canned salmon is a budget-friendly alternative.
- You can swap sriracha with a milder hot sauce if you prefer less heat.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Sushi Rice
Rinse the sushi rice under cold water until it runs clear. Combine it with the three cups of water in a rice cooker and cook according to the machine’s instructions. Alternatively, you can cook it on the stove.
Step 2: Season the Salmon
While your rice is cooking, pre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Season your fresh salmon fillet with a drizzle of soy sauce, sesame oil, and a sprinkle of salt. Bake for 15-20 minutes or until cooked through.
Step 3: Make the Spicy Mayo
In a small bowl, mix mayonnaise with sriracha sauce to create the spicy mayo. Adjust the sriracha to your taste preference!
Step 4: Combine
Once the rice is ready, fluff it with a fork and let it cool slightly. In a large mixing bowl, combine the sushi rice, baked salmon (flaked), spicy mayo, and chopped green onions until well incorporated.
Step 5: Bake
Spread the mixture evenly in a baking dish and bake for an additional 10-15 minutes until heated through and slightly golden on top.
Step 6: Garnish and Serve
Top with sliced avocado and more green onions. Serve hot and enjoy!

Healthier Alternatives for the Recipe
Looking for ways to enhance the nutritional profile of your Easy Spicy Salmon Sushi Bake Recipe? Here are some modifications:
- Use quinoa instead of sushi rice for an added protein punch.
- Substitute Greek yogurt for mayonnaise to cut down on calories and add extra protein.
- Toss in some steamed broccoli or carrots to sneak in more vegetables and fiber.
Serving Suggestions
Serve your sushi bake with soy sauce, pickled ginger, and wasabi on the side for a complete experience. You can also enjoy it with a salad or miso soup for a Japanese-inspired meal.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Overcooking the Rice: Ensure that you follow the cooking instructions to maintain the perfect sushi rice texture.
- Skimping on Seasoning: Don’t hesitate to season the salmon well; this dish relies on bold flavors!
- Baking Too Long: Keep an eye on the baking process; you want it just golden, not burnt.
Storing Tips for the Recipe
Have leftovers? Here’s how to store them:
- Refrigerate: Keep the sushi bake in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
- Freeze: If you want to store it longer, freeze individual portions in freezer-safe bags for up to 3 months. Reheat in the oven before serving.
Easy Spicy Salmon Sushi Bake
- Total Time: 25 minutes
- Yield: 4–6 servings 1x
Description
This Easy Spicy Salmon Sushi Bake is a creamy, spicy, and flavorful dish inspired by sushi rolls. Layers of seasoned sushi rice, spicy salmon, and melted cheese make it a crowd-pleasing casserole perfect for weeknight dinners or gatherings.
Ingredients
Ingredients
- 2 cups cooked sushi rice
- 1 lb fresh salmon, cooked and flaked
- 1/2 cup mayonnaise
- 2–3 tbsp sriracha sauce (adjust to taste)
- 1 tbsp soy sauce
- 1 tsp sesame oil
- 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ella or Monterey Jack cheese
- 1 sheet nori, cut into strips for garnish
- Optional: sliced green onions and sesame seeds for garnish
Instructions
Instructions
- Preheat oven: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and lightly grease a 9×9-inch baking dish.
- Prepare spicy salmon mixture: In a bowl, combine flaked salmon, mayonnaise, sriracha, soy sauce, and sesame oil. Mix well.
- Layer the bake: Spread cooked sushi rice evenly in the prepared baking dish. Top with the spicy salmon mixture and sprinkle shredded cheese on top.
- Bake: Bake in the preheated oven for 12–15 minutes, until cheese is melted and slightly golden.
- Remove from oven and garnish with nori strips, sliced green onions, and sesame seeds.
- Serve warm, scooping portions onto individual plates or over seaweed for a sushi-style experience.
Notes
Adjust the spiciness by adding more or less sriracha. Leftovers can be refrigerated for up to 2 days and reheated gently.

FAQs
Q1: Can I use frozen salmon for this recipe?
Yes, thaw it completely before baking to ensure even cooking.
Q2: Is this recipe gluten-free?
Use gluten-free soy sauce to make it gluten-free.
Q3: How can I adjust the spice level?
Simply reduce the amount of sriracha according to your taste, or add more for an extra kick!
